US Support for Colombia: Growth, Peace, and Security

This act provides financial and technical support from the United States to Colombia. The aim is to improve the economic situation, strengthen security, protect human rights, and provide humanitarian aid, contributing to greater stability and prosperity in the country.
Key points
Support for small and medium-sized businesses in Colombia, including women-owned businesses and those in digital and agricultural sectors.
Efforts to promote nearshoring of supply chains, potentially impacting the regional economy.
Strengthened cooperation in combating crime, drug trafficking, and cyber threats.
Funding for programs protecting tropical forests and fighting illegal environmental activities.
Assistance for Afro-Colombian and Indigenous communities and support for human rights defenders.
Support for education (English language, STEM) to improve job opportunities.
Humanitarian aid for internally displaced persons, refugees, and migrants.
